What countries bordered the Berlin Wall?

Best Answers

Well, as it's name suggests, it was a wall that divided two halves of one city. Berlin is located well within Germany proper, so the only country that bordered the Berlin Wall was what was then East Germany. The Berlin Wall was built around the western occupation zones of Berlin. read more

Berlin is located well within East Germany proper, so the only country that bordered the Berlin Wall was then East Germany. The Berlin Wall was built around the Western occupied sectors of Berlin. The Soviet sector did not have a surrounding wall, only one that met the British, French, and American sectores to the west. read more

Before the Wall's erection, 3.5 million East Germans circumvented Eastern Bloc emigration restrictions and defected from the GDR, many by crossing over the border from East Berlin into West Berlin; from there they could then travel to West Germany and to other Western European countries. read more
